Qualifications
- Certification: Not required to apply
- Education: High School Diploma or GED
- BLS Certification: Required within 90 days of hire
- Experience: 6 months of clinical experience preferred (primary care or outpatient a plus)

About Company
Mercy is one of the largest U.S. health systems with 44 acute care & specialty hospitals, over 700 physician & outpatient clinics in Arkansas, Kansas, Missouri & Oklahoma.
